This is the third plush car I've designed (and my first that isn't fannish!), this time as a commission. She was very happy with it, which makes me happy, too :-)

No. 11 in my series of plush toys.

It's a 2007 Chevrolet Monte Carlo!



As with all the other cars I've done, the headlights glow in the dark. I was in a rush to send out the car and didn't have time to try for a photo with the lights out.









This was based on a real car, which is why I've pixelated the license plate. The plate itself looks crooked in the photo, but it's something to do with the camera angle; it looks fine in person.


It was a lot of work, but I'm really pleased how this baby turned out.
